Transaction 3ef2a5baa0435c8e016a1ce75d21976bb2decd91e565a7a11eb7476956bd24ec

1 Input
2 Outputs
  • 3ef2a5baa0435c8e016a1ce75d21976bb2decd91e565a7a11eb7476956bd24ec:0
  • value  317668327
    address  16ajRrMPAWucoE1AKZUPutvpxSjqoZ6LC8
  • 3ef2a5baa0435c8e016a1ce75d21976bb2decd91e565a7a11eb7476956bd24ec:1
  • value  25000000
    address  1BJYCGJtYu8ondfhPjKxyeBjBdxsfNEhgm